Photovoltaic system repair services focus on diagnosing and fixing issues that can affect the performance and efficiency of solar power systems. Technicians inspect components such as solar panels, inverters, wiring, and mounting hardware to identify faults or damage. Repairs may involve replacing malfunctioning inverters, repairing damaged wiring, or addressing issues with mounting structures to ensure the system operates safely and effectively. Proper repair services help maintain optimal energy production and extend the lifespan of the solar installation.

These services address common problems like reduced energy output, system shutdowns, or electrical faults that can occur over time due to weather exposure, wear and tear, or installation issues. Faulty inverters can cause the entire system to underperform, while damaged wiring or loose connections may lead to safety hazards or system failures. Repair professionals work to troubleshoot these issues efficiently, restoring the system’s functionality and ensuring it continues to generate power reliably.

The overview below groups typical Photovoltaic System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Durham, NH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ost of Repairs - Repair costs for photovoltaic systems typically range from $300 to $1,500, depending on the extent of the damage. Minor repairs such as replacing a few damaged panels may be closer to the lower end, while extensive component replacements can reach higher figures.

Labor Expenses - Labor charges for photovoltaic system repairs generally fall between $50 and $150 per hour. Total labor costs depend on the complexity of the repair and the size of the system needing service.

Part Replacement Costs - Replacing damaged inverters or panels might cost between $200 and $2,000 per component. The overall expense varies based on the part's type, brand, and system compatibility.

Additional Fees - Extra costs such as permit fees or diagnostic assessments can add a few hundred dollars to the total. These fees depend on local regulations and the specific repair requ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common issues that require photovoltaic system repairs? Common issues include inverter failures, shading problems, damaged panels, loose wiring, and inverter error messages that can affect system performance.

How can I tell if my photovoltaic system needs repair? Signs include a noticeable drop in energy production, frequent system errors, or physical damage to panels or wiring that may indicate the need for professional inspection and repair.

What types of repairs do photovoltaic system service providers typically perform? Service providers often handle inverter replacements, wiring repairs, panel cleaning or replacement, and troubleshooting system errors to restore optimal performance.

Is it necessary to replace my entire photovoltaic system if it stops working? Not necessarily; many issues can be resolved through targeted repairs or component replacements without the need for a full system replacement.
